Harnessing Harmony: The Power of Music Therapy

Wiki Article

Music therapy leverages the powerful energy of music to address a broad range of physical, emotional, and cognitive needs. Through intentionally chosen musical experiences, music therapists support individuals in exploring their feelings, developing interpersonal skills, and reaching their personal goals.

Music therapy can benefit people of all ages and situations. It has been demonstrated to be highly successful for individuals with learning disorders,, mental health issues,, and long-term conditions.

Lyrics for Healing: Exploring Therapeutic Music Songwriting

Music has long been recognized as its power to soothe. Therapeutic music songwriting takes this concept a step further, empowering individuals to write lyrics that process their emotions and experiences. This deeply personal journey can act as a powerful tool for overcoming emotional challenges, fostering self-discovery, and ultimately promoting well-being.

Through the honesty of songwriting, individuals can delve into their inner worlds, giving voice to feelings that may be difficult to share in other ways. The act of putting copyright to music provides a safe and creative outlet for expression.

Therapeutic songwriting is often used in settings such as therapy, support groups, or individual sessions. A qualified therapist or music facilitator can direct participants through the songwriting process, providing structure and ensuring a safe environment.
